Pretzels and Cheese Dip

Soft Pretzels with Cheese Dip for the Ultimate Snack Experience

Delight in homemade soft pretzels paired with velvety cheese dip for the ultimate snack experience.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Resting Time 10 minutes
Total Time 40 minutes
Servings: 8 pretzels
Course: Snacks
Cuisine: American
Calories: 240

Ingredients
  

For the Pretzels
  • 4 cups All-Purpose Flour Provides the perfect structure
  • 1 packet Instant Rise Yeast Vital for leavening
  • 1.5 cups Lukewarm Water Activate the yeast, warm to the touch
  • 1 tablespoon Brown Sugar Adds sweetness and helps with browning
  • 1 teaspoon Salt Enhances flavor
  • 2 tablespoons Unsalted Butter Adds richness
  • 0.5 cups Baking Soda Essential for the boiling bath
  • 1 large Egg (beaten) Gives pretzels a shiny finish
  • 2 teaspoons Coarse Salt A must for topping
For the Cheese Dip
  • 1 cup Whole Milk Ensures creamy consistency
  • 1 cup Sharp Cheddar Cheese Star ingredient for flavor
  • Optional Add-ins Jalapeños, hot sauce, cayenne pepper, mustard, or horseradish

Equipment

  • Mixing Bowl
  • Baking sheets
  • Saucepan
  • Slotted spoon
  • whisk

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. In a mixing bowl, combine lukewarm water with instant rise yeast and let it sit for about 5 minutes until frothy.
  2. Stir in melted unsalted butter, brown sugar, and salt until well combined.
  3. Gradually add all-purpose flour, mixing until a dough begins to form.
  4. Transfer the dough onto a floured surface and knead for approximately 2 minutes until smooth and elastic.
  5. Cover the dough with a clean towel and let it rest for 10 minutes at room temperature.
  6. Preheat oven to 425°F and line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
  7. Divide the rested dough into 8 equal pieces, roll each piece into a 24-inch rope, and shape into pretzels.
  8. Boil 6 cups of water and add in 1/2 cup baking soda.
  9. Carefully drop the pretzels into the boiling solution one at a time, boiling for about 20 seconds.
  10. Remove each pretzel with a slotted spoon and place on the baking sheets.
  11. Brush each pretzel with the beaten egg and sprinkle with coarse salt.
  12. Bake for 12-15 minutes until golden brown and puffed.
  13. In a saucepan, heat whole milk over medium heat, melt unsalted butter, and whisk in flour until golden.
  14. Gradually pour in warmed milk, stirring until thickened, then add shredded sharp cheddar cheese until smooth.
